Edgar A. Rassiner was born in 1891 in Louisville, Kentucky, United States.
He graduated at the DuPont Manual Training School in 1908, and following a two-year course (1911-12) in Structural Engineering at the Louisville Institute of Technology, he began architectural a study at the city's Beaux Arts Institute of Design.
After studies he employed in local architectural offices (Louisville).
In 1922 Mr Rassiner was appointed Architect to the City Board of Education, and in the two ensuing years was engaged in designing school buildings, among them the Clark and the Emerson. After 1923 he practiced independently with an office in the Louisville Trust Building, preparing plans for a number of public and commercial buildings, also several city residences.
